What do i have to do to install the GMPP exhaust???

I just ordered the GMPP exhaust and do not want to pay the $250 the dealership wanted to charge me to install it. I am wondering do i have to cut anything on the stock one and i was told that the GMPPs are bolt on systems. If i wanted to keep the stock tip and put it on the new exhaust could I? PLease let me know whatever you guys know.

cut the stock one out, bolt the new system on, you have to buy the muffler seperatley and it comes with a better tip, i paid 40 bux for the install but if u have the tools you can easily do it yourself, just becareful where you cut the stocker.
